K, so there are a lot of resources here on the site for this stuff, but,

1. Yes all S2000's have LSD
2. AP1 is divided into 2 specific segments - MY99-01:
-all MY99-03 have the F20C - 2.0L 4cyl revs out at 9K with 237hp and 150 something tq.
-plastic rear window prone to distortion
-stiffer rear spring rate than front (they like to rotate the most)
-2 speaker audio system
-"safest" ECU form fact - runs richest of all MY

MY02-03:
-glass rear window
-storage pockets, 4 speaker audio
-stiffer front spring rate than rear
-tan interior option offered

3. Then we have the AP2 from MY04 to present with there own changes. MY04-05:
-Most important the engine: for US market only the F22 - 2.2L 4cyl revs out at 8K same hp about 10 more tq was fitted to the AP2 chassis...everywhere else in the world the F20C carries on til MY07.
-transmission: individual gear ratios are changed to work in harmony with the F22 and deliver more mid range punch
-pretty sure the clutch delay valve was installed on the 04's in an attempt to lessen the stress on the LSD during hard acceleration - most S2ki guys consider this instalment to be B.S. and remove it.
-susapension is softened from spring rates to shock dampening as well as changes to sway bar diameter in an effort to "tame" the tendency to rotate more than your average driver can handle during cornering
-the mounting points are changed in the suspension in an effort to make the car more stable.
-wheels and tires are changed to a larger size and wheels are non staggered while tires remain staggered.

MY06:
-user defeatable Vehicle Stability Assist is added in an effort to further lessen the risk of an inexperienced driver letting the roadster with 50/50 weight distribution get away form them.
-the very deisreable Laguna Blue pearl/Monte Carlo Blue Pearl from the NSX is added. You'll find all of the colors the S2000 comes in are from the NSX originally.

MY07-08
-suspension is further softened
-Club Racer CR model is added with no softop, optional radio and AC delete offered, track friendly suspension, and aero package. It comes in colors and interior trim unique to standard S2000.

Originally Posted by super_dave9898,May 4 2008, 02:26 PM
The AP1 has 240hp not 237hp, the AP2 has the 237hp
Horsepower is actually the same, it got bumped down to 237 because Honda started using a different way to calculate horsepower. Most dynos that I have seen put both ap1s and ap2s at around the same horsepower. That is usually just above 200 whp depending on the weather conditions and type of dyno being used.

One thing about S2000's:

It might just be the most crashed car on the planet. Check the Carfax, and find a local body man to take a look at the car. I saw some wicked damage before I found the S2K that I decided to buy.

If you live in a Northern Climate, and plan on enjoying the car between late fall and early spring, try to locate a car with a hard top already attached. Adding one later is an expensive PITA, and the hard top doesn't add anything to the resale value compared to what it costs to buy one, paint it, buy the hardware, and have it adjusted to fit.

If you want a clean, unmolested car, check for cars that have been "unmodified" prior to being put up for sale. Cutouts in the fender liners and front bumper area are easy to see, and a dead giveaway that a forced induction system was busy stressing the engine. Other things to look for might vary from system to system. If you wonder how common this is, check for "part-out" sales in the classified section.
